หน้า: [1]   ลงล่าง
  พิมพ์  
ผู้เขียน หัวข้อ: VMware server นี่จองแรมยังไงครับ  (อ่าน 12433 ครั้ง)
0 สมาชิก และ 1 บุคคลทั่วไป กำลังดูหัวข้อนี้
SwensenS
Newbie
*
ออฟไลน์ ออฟไลน์

กระทู้: 7


ดูรายละเอียด
« เมื่อ: ธันวาคม 09, 2009, 12:41:04 AM »

ผมลงwin2003server+ VMware server

คือว่าผมลง4 osเป็นlinuxทั้งหมด แบ่งแรมosละ1.5GB

เข้าไปใน linux พิมคำว่า free ปรากฏว่ากินแรมทั้งหมด1.5เลย

แต่เข้าเครื่องหลักดูตรง task manager 4os รวมกันทำไมกินแค่ 1จิกกว่าๆเองครับ

เราจะเซตให้จองแรมไปเลยได้ใหมครับ VMware-server1.0.6-91891

บันทึกการเข้า
cluangar
Administrator
Hero Member
*****
ออฟไลน์ ออฟไลน์

กระทู้: 761


ดูรายละเอียด
« ตอบ #1 เมื่อ: ธันวาคม 09, 2009, 08:58:23 AM »

  VMware Server จุดที่ต่างกันที่สู้ VMware ESX คือการบริหารจัดการ Resouce ทั้ง CPU, Memory, Disk ที่ Server ไม่สามารถจัดการได้อย่างมีประสิทธิภาพ
  ส่วนการที่ Linux จอง Memory ทั้งหมดเป็นปรกติของเขาครับ  ไม่ต้องตกใจ  มันต่างกับ Win ที่จะใช้ค่อยกิน Memory แต่ Linux จะยึด Memory ทั้งหมดไปแล้วไปแบ่งจัดสันให้กับ application อีกทีจนกว่าจะมีการเริ่มใช้ Swap อย่างมากมายนั้นถึงจะหมายถึง Memory ที่ตั้งให้เริ่มไม่เพียงพอ
  การจอง Memory ที่เรา Set ให้กับ OS นั้นทำได้แค่นั้นครับ  โดย VMware จะไปบริหารการจัดการ Memory อีกทีเลยเห็นยังไม่เต็มเท่ากับจำนวน Memory ที่เราจองให้กับแต่ละ VM รวมกัน  แต่ถ้าใช้ไปเรื่อยๆและ VM แต่ละตัวเริ่มใช้ Memory หลักจริงๆ  จะเห็นตัวเลขของการใช้ Memory ใน Host ค่อยๆเพิ่มไปเรื่อยเองครับ  โดยจะเท่ากับ Memory ที่เรา Set ให้ในแต่ละ VM รวมกัน  + ค่า Overhead ของ VMware ในแต่ละ VM ด้วยครับ
บันทึกการเข้า
pickianeme
Newbie
*
ออฟไลน์ ออฟไลน์

กระทู้: 30


ดูรายละเอียด
« ตอบ #2 เมื่อ: ธันวาคม 11, 2009, 11:24:34 AM »

สงสัยอยุ่อย่างครับ

ว่าค่า Memory Overhead ที่แตกต่างกันของแต่ล่ะ VM  นี้ มันคำนวณจากอะไร ครับ  ฮืม

พอจะทราบไหมครับ   ยิงฟันยิ้ม
บันทึกการเข้า
cluangar
Administrator
Hero Member
*****
ออฟไลน์ ออฟไลน์

กระทู้: 761


ดูรายละเอียด
« ตอบ #3 เมื่อ: ธันวาคม 11, 2009, 12:12:48 PM »

  vmware server อันนี้ผมไม่มีตารางคำนวณนะครับ  แต่ของ ESX จะมี  โดยปรกติ 64bits Guest จะเสีย overhead แยะกว่า 32bits ไว้จะลองหาดูครับ
บันทึกการเข้า
pickianeme
Newbie
*
ออฟไลน์ ออฟไลน์

กระทู้: 30


ดูรายละเอียด
« ตอบ #4 เมื่อ: ธันวาคม 11, 2009, 02:28:01 PM »


บังเอิญหาไปเรื่อย ๆ แล้วไปเจอมาครับ

สำหรับ ESX3.xx

http://pubs.vmware.com/vi301/resmgmt/wwhelp/wwhimpl/common/html/wwhelp.htm?context=resmgmt&file=vc_advanced_mgmt.11.18.html

สำหรับ ESX4.xx

http://pubs.vmware.com/vsp40/wwhelp/wwhimpl/js/html/wwhelp.htm#href=resmgmt/r_overhead_memory_on_virtual_machines.html

แบ่งกานน ชม  ยิงฟันยิ้ม
บันทึกการเข้า
cluangar
Administrator
Hero Member
*****
ออฟไลน์ ออฟไลน์

กระทู้: 761


ดูรายละเอียด
« ตอบ #5 เมื่อ: ธันวาคม 11, 2009, 02:38:01 PM »

ขอบคุณครับ
บันทึกการเข้า
หน้า: [1]   ขึ้นบน
  พิมพ์  
 
กระโดดไป: